Chip ,at first we thought the engine locked up. I called myself checking down the list
water full in radiator
no dents in pan
pulled valve covers and everything in place

pulled plugs and all good ( did find not enough jetting )

so i just pulled the plug for the day and time had run out for 1st round..
Got home and thinking all the way to the shop i decided to to look at torque converter...

Guess what ,,,,one bolt had came out and wedged between flywheel and motor in a very hard place to see.
Got bolt out after about a 30 minutes battle.. Replaced bolt and checked over everything once again and cranked the motor and ran perfect.....
Glad we don't have to pull motor . Just was not meant to be at 1st round for some reason ...

It is fixed and ready to battle again.
It was not a total lost as we did re-set the L/SA record at a 12.21..which i am very proud of....

Quote:

Originally Posted by Chris1529 (Post 252314)
what is a byow policy?

Bring Your Own Water. ;)

Had to ask several times for water in the burnout box. Would roll through and get the tire wet all the way around, back up, leave a coulpe feet in front of me, bring it up to 2800 in 1st gear and mat it, and it barely got to 5500 rpm, never even got to pull 2nd. :confused: I always see several instances of people having problems doing a burnout at MIR. I almost wonder if there's something different in the concrete there, because even Pageland Dragway only has 2-3ft of water tops, and I never have a problem doing a burnout there (or anywhere else). Are they spraying traction compound all the way back to and including the box?

Chip - prolly gonna be Thursday morning before I can get out of here. Schedule's killing me. Good luck at Piedmont this weekend.

Jim Kaekel 04-12-2011 03:00 PM

Re: LIVE from MIR Pro-Am
 
I've seen on occasion where concrete was replaced in the water box area and due to the lack of an initial smooth surface (not enough water in the concrete mix?), it made burn-outs difficult.
